Inteligencia artificial
Redes Neuronales Líquidas: Definición, Aplicaciones y Desafíos

Una red neuronal (NN) es un algoritmo de aprendizaje automático que imita la estructura y las capacidades operativas del cerebro humano para reconocer patrones a partir de datos de entrenamiento. A través de su red de neuronas artificiales interconectadas que procesan y transmiten información, las redes neuronales pueden realizar tareas complejas como el reconocimiento facial, la comprensión del lenguaje natural y el análisis predictivo sin asistencia humana.
A pesar de ser una poderosa herramienta de inteligencia artificial, las redes neuronales tienen ciertas limitaciones, como:
- Requieren una cantidad sustancial de datos de entrenamiento etiquetados.
- Procesan los datos de manera no secuencial, lo que las hace ineficientes para manejar datos en tiempo real.
Por lo tanto, un grupo de investigadores del Laboratorio de Ciencias de la Computación e Inteligencia Artificial (CSAIL) de MIT introdujo “Redes Neuronales Líquidas o LNNs – un tipo de red neuronal que aprende en el trabajo, no solo durante la fase de entrenamiento.”
Exploraremos las LNNs en detalle a continuación.
¿Qué son las Redes Neuronales Líquidas (LNNs)? – Un análisis profundo
Una Red Neuronal Líquida es una red neuronal recurrente (RNN) tiempo-continua que procesa los datos secuencialmente, mantiene la memoria de las entradas pasadas, ajusta su comportamiento según las nuevas entradas y puede manejar entradas de longitud variable para mejorar las capacidades de comprensión de tareas de las NN.
La arquitectura de LNN se diferencia de las redes neuronales tradicionales debido a su capacidad para procesar datos continuos o de serie de tiempo de manera efectiva. Si hay nuevos datos disponibles, las LNN pueden cambiar el número de neuronas y conexiones por capa.
Los pioneros de la Red Neuronal Líquida, Ramin Hasani, Mathias Lechner y otros, han tomado inspiración del nematodo microscópico C.elegans, un gusano de 1 mm de largo con un sistema nervioso exhaustivamente estructurado, que le permite realizar tareas complejas como encontrar comida, dormir y aprender del entorno.
“Solo tiene 302 neuronas en su sistema nervioso”, dice Hasani, “y sin embargo, puede generar dinámicas inesperadamente complejas.”
Las LNN imitan las conexiones eléctricas interconectadas o impulsos del gusano para predecir el comportamiento de la red con el tiempo. La red expresa el estado del sistema en cualquier momento dado. Esto es una desviación del enfoque tradicional de NN que presenta el estado del sistema en un momento específico.
Por lo tanto, las Redes Neuronales Líquidas tienen dos características clave:
- Arquitectura dinámica: Sus neuronas son más expresivas que las neuronas de una red neuronal regular, lo que hace que las LNN sean más interpretables. Pueden manejar datos secuenciales en tiempo real de manera efectiva.
- Aprendizaje continuo y adaptabilidad: Las LNN se adaptan a los datos cambiantes incluso después del entrenamiento, imitando el cerebro de los organismos vivos de manera más precisa en comparación con las NN tradicionales que dejan de aprender nueva información después de la fase de entrenamiento del modelo. Por lo tanto, las LNN no requieren grandes cantidades de datos de entrenamiento etiquetados para generar resultados precisos.
Dado que las neuronas de LLM ofrecen conexiones ricas que pueden expresar más información, son más pequeñas en tamaño en comparación con las NN regulares. Por lo tanto, es más fácil para los investigadores explicar cómo una LNN llegó a una decisión. Además, un tamaño de modelo más pequeño y menos cálculos pueden hacer que sean escalables a nivel empresarial. Además, estas redes son más resistentes al ruido y las perturbaciones en la señal de entrada en comparación con las NN.
3 Casos de uso principales de las Redes Neuronales Líquidas

Las Redes Neuronales Líquidas brillan en casos de uso que involucran datos secuenciales continuos, como:
1. Procesamiento y predicción de datos de serie de tiempo
Los investigadores enfrentan varios desafíos mientras modelan datos de serie de tiempo, incluyendo dependencias temporales, no estacionariedad y ruido en los datos de serie de tiempo.
Las Redes Neuronales Líquidas están diseñadas para el procesamiento y predicción de datos de serie de tiempo. Según Hasani, los datos de serie de tiempo son cruciales y ubicuos para comprender el mundo de manera correcta. “El mundo real es todo sobre secuencias. Incluso nuestra percepción —- no estás percibiendo imágenes, estás percibiendo secuencias de imágenes”, dice.
2. Procesamiento de imágenes y video
Las LNN pueden realizar tareas de procesamiento de imágenes y visión, como seguimiento de objetos, segmentación de imágenes y reconocimiento. Su naturaleza dinámica les permite mejorar continuamente en función de la complejidad del entorno, los patrones y la dinámica temporal.
Por ejemplo, los investigadores de MIT encontraron que los drones pueden ser guiados por un modelo LNN de 20,000 parámetros que funciona mejor en la navegación de entornos no vistos anteriormente que otras redes neuronales. Estas excelentes capacidades de navegación pueden ser utilizadas en la construcción de vehículos autónomos más precisos.
3. Comprensión del lenguaje natural
Debido a su adaptabilidad, capacidad de aprendizaje en tiempo real y topología dinámica, las Redes Neuronales Líquidas son muy buenas para comprender secuencias de texto de lenguaje natural largas.
Consideremos el análisis de sentimiento, una tarea de NLP que tiene como objetivo comprender la emoción subyacente detrás del texto. La capacidad de las LNN para aprender de datos en tiempo real les ayuda a analizar el dialecto en evolución y las nuevas frases, lo que permite un análisis de sentimiento más preciso. Capacidades similares pueden ser útiles en la traducción automática.
Restricciones y desafíos de las Redes Neuronales Líquidas

Aunque las Redes Neuronales Líquidas han superado a las redes neuronales tradicionales que eran inflexibles, trabajando en patrones fijos y contextos independientes. Pero tienen algunas restricciones y desafíos también.
1. Problema de gradiente desvaneciente
Al igual que otros modelos tiempo-continuos, las LNN pueden experimentar el problema de gradiente desvaneciente cuando se entrenan con descenso de gradiente. En redes neuronales profundas, el problema de gradiente desvaneciente ocurre cuando los gradientes utilizados para actualizar los pesos de las redes neuronales se vuelven extremadamente pequeños. Este problema evita que las redes neuronales alcancen los pesos óptimos. Esto puede limitar su capacidad para aprender dependencias a largo plazo de manera efectiva.
2. Ajuste de parámetros
Al igual que otras redes neuronales, las LNN también involucran el desafío de ajuste de parámetros. El ajuste de parámetros es costoso y consume tiempo para las Redes Neuronales Líquidas. Las LNN tienen múltiples parámetros, incluyendo la elección de ODE (Ecuaciones Diferenciales Ordinarias), parámetros de regularización y arquitectura de la red, que deben ajustarse para lograr el mejor rendimiento.
Encontrar la configuración de parámetros adecuada a menudo requiere un proceso iterativo, que lleva tiempo. Si el ajuste de parámetros es ineficiente o no se realiza correctamente, puede resultar en una respuesta de red subóptima y un rendimiento reducido. Sin embargo, los investigadores están tratando de superar este problema al descubrir cómo se pueden necesitar menos neuronas para realizar una tarea específica.
3. Falta de literatura
Las Redes Neuronales Líquidas tienen una literatura limitada sobre implementación, aplicación y beneficios. La investigación limitada hace que sea desafiante comprender el máximo potencial y las limitaciones de las LNN. Son menos reconocidas que las Redes Neuronales Convolucionales (CNN), RNN o la arquitectura de transformadores. Los investigadores aún están experimentando con sus posibles casos de uso.
Las redes neuronales han evolucionado desde la Red Neuronal de Capas Múltiples (MLP) hasta las Redes Neuronales Líquidas. Las LNN son más dinámicas, adaptables, eficientes y robustas que las redes neuronales tradicionales y tienen muchos casos de uso potenciales.
Construir sobre los hombros de gigantes; a medida que la IA continúa evolucionando rápidamente, veremos nuevas técnicas de última generación que abordan los desafíos y restricciones de las técnicas actuales con beneficios adicionales.
Para más contenido relacionado con la IA, visite unite.ai










